谷歌Android Studio 3.5正式版发布: 稳步推进Project Marble计划( 三 )

自动推荐内存设置

在Android Studio 3.5中,IDE会识别出一个应用项目在RAM容量更高的机器上何时需要更多的RAM,并在通知开发者增加内存堆大小;或者您也可以在Appearance & Behavior→Memory Settings下自行调整设置。

谷歌Android Studio 3.5正式版发布: 稳步推进Project Marble计划

内存设置

用户界面冻结

在Project Marble计划开发期间,我们在产品分析数据中发现IDE中的XML代码编辑速度明显较慢。我们基于这个数据点优化了XML输入,使得Android Studio 3.5的性能表现有了极大的提升。从以下两张图中您可以发现,得益于输入延迟的改进,使用XML编辑数据绑定表达式的速度明显加快了。

改进前:在Android Studio 3.4中编辑代码

改进后:在Android Studio 3.5中编辑代码

构建速度

为了提高Android Studio 3.5的构建速度,我们采取了许多措施,其中最为重要的一项变更是为顶级注释处理器添加增量构建支持,这些处理器包括Glide、AndroidX data binding、Dagger、Realm和Kotlin (KAPT)。增量支持能够显著提高构建速度。更多内容,请阅读《在Android Studio中加快构建速度》。

推荐阅读